Why does 4 Muffins A La Myrtille have a Nutri-Score of D?

Nutri-Score weighs negatives (calories, sugar, saturated fat, sodium) against positives (fiber, protein) per 100 g. Points against come from calorie density (370 kcal), sugar (30 g). Overall that places it in band D.
